Membership Committee Bob Warrington (chair), Scott Bryant, James Wylde, Barry Alexia, Kees Eijkel, Erol Harvey Only a few organizations focus on miniaturization technologies and very few combine miniaturization technologies with commercialization. MANCEF brings together technologists, businesspersons, entrepreneurs, academicians, companies, technologies, policy makers, and researchers. Since its incorporation in the December of 2000, MANCEF has granted memberships in MANCEF to each COMS (Commercialization of Micro and Nano Systems) conference attendees. While this practice continues, MANCEF wants to extend its membership base, whetherindividual and organizational across academia, industry, and government sectors.
